10 Ways to Wear Your Hair Every Day

The way you wear your hair says a lot about you. Though that can be a little stressful, it is also super exciting! You get to wake up every day and choose how you want to wear your hair and you have all the control! Pick a couple of go to’s that work for you no matter what the event.

If you need help picking out those go to’s, or you are just looking for some new ideas on how to spruce up your hair game, then check out these styles below!

1.) High Ponytail

A high pony tail is great because it is so versatile. You can wear this to a fancy event and look super elegant or you can wear it to the gym and fit right in. It is up to you how you wear it, but no matter how, it will look beautiful!

I like to leave pieces down around my face to frame the makeup that I am wearing.

2.) Low Ponytail

Now, it is important to be careful with a low pony tail because done wrong it can actually hurt whatever outfit you are trying to wear it with. But done right, it works so well!

Make sure however you decide to do it emphasizes your face and makeup. Leave the right pieces down framing your face and make sure that you have enough volume so it doesn’t look super oily.

3.) Half Up Half Down

This is the best hairstyle for when you are on the go and need a quick and east way to look polished and finished! Also, if you touch your hair a lot and that tends to make it greasy, this is a good way to prolong your hair washing time.

4.) Up Do

Save this one for your like semi fancy events. Like your friends baby shower or your cousins engagement party. You can YouTube super easy and really regal up dos so that you can accomplish this look at home.

I like to wear an up do when wearing a higher neckline because I think that it emphasizes your face and whatever makeup you decide to wear that day.

5.) Barrettes

Though the picture below might be a little bit excessive for you, barrettes have made a come back and they are a fabulous way to spruce up any hairstyle! You can wear them when your hair is up, down, in a bun, whatever. They add just the right amount of sparkle and shine to any outfit. 

They are not even super expensive to buy. Most of the time you can pick them up locally or online for like $5.99 for 3 different styles of barrettes.

If you are looking for a way to add something unique and some sparkle, then look no further!

6.) Curling Iron

Curling your hair is much more difficult than straightening it because there are so many different ways to do and so many decisions to make.

Depending on the length of your hair, you need to choose the size curling iron you want to use. It also depends what kind of curls you are looking for. It is definitely doable but just do your research and practice first!

7.) Straightened

The one and only thing (well maybe not the only) but definitely so important to remember when straightening your hair, is to spray it with heat protection before you begin. You spend years and hundreds of dollars to grow and take care of your hair! Don’t spoil it with one fell swoop of your over heated straightener! Protect that hair and take the proper precautions!

Also, moisturize with argon oil seeing as heat tends to dry out our hair.

See Also

8.) Slicked Back

This is the best way to wear your hair when you are on your fourth day of not washing and you have an important meeting or class that you are rushing to. Not only does it look super planned and polished and sophisticated, you don’t have to worry about it looking too greasy. No one can tell grease and hairspray apart!

So if you are waiting to wash your hair but you have somewhere important to make it to, don’t fret. Grab your spray bottle and dampen your hair, then get to work with a comb brushing everything back. Once you have it in the style you want, spray that baby until it shines like the sun!

9.) Braids

We don’t all have this talent, I know. So don’t worry if this style just isn’t in your wheelhouse. You have 9 other fabulous options! If you want to learn how to braid though, there are tons of easy to follow YouTube tutorials you can check out!

If you already know how to braid, then don’t be afraid to add that talent into your every day wardrobe. There are hundreds of different kinds of braids: fish tale, dutch french braid, french braid, etc. Pick one and get to braiding! This is a talent that not everyone has so show it off!

10.) Messy Bun/Top Not

Ah the elusive messy bun. Not as easy to achieve as one may think. Or as the name lends us to think when we begin our attempts. Usually the quick messy bun takes time to arrange and perfect before we get that perfectly messy look.

My advice is to take your time when doing the perfect messy bun or top not. It is supposed to look effortless, though we know it isn’t, don’t loose that look in your haste to get it perfect.

Once you have the perfect bun, don’t be afraid to spruce it up with the aforementioned barrettes or even a scarf or a headband!
